Types of Indoor Cat Doors
When it pertains to indoor cat doors, there are a number of types to select from, each with its own unique attributes and advantages:
- Magnetic Cat Doors: These doors utilize a magnetic closure system to keep the door shut, and are perfect for smaller cats and kittens.
- Spring-Loaded Cat Doors: These doors utilize a spring-loaded system to keep the door shut, and are appropriate for larger cats and multi-cat families.
- Electronic Cat Doors: These doors use sensors and motors to manage access, and are perfect for tech-savvy owners who want a high-tech service.
- Handbook Cat Doors: These doors require manual opening and closing, and are perfect for owners who prefer a more traditional approach.
Installation Process
Setting up an indoor cat door is a relatively straightforward process that requires some fundamental DIY abilities and tools. Here's a detailed guide to assist you get going:
Tools Needed:
- Drill and bits
- Screwdriver and screws
- Measuring tape
- Level
- Pencil and marker
- Shatterproof glass and a dust mask (optional)
Step 1: Choose the Perfect Location
When choosing the perfect area for your indoor cat door, consider the following factors:
- Traffic: Choose a location with minimal foot traffic to prevent accidents and stress.
- Availability: Ensure the area is easily available for your cat, and ideally near a food source or litter box.
- Environment: Avoid areas with extreme temperatures, wetness, or drafts.
Step 2: Measure and Mark the Door
Procedure the width of your cat door and mark the center point on the wall or door frame. Use a level to make sure the mark is straight, and a pencil to draw the line along the length of the door.
Step 3: Cut Out the Door
Use a drill and bits to cut out a hole for the cat door, following the producer's directions for size and shape.
Step 4: Install the Door Frame
Install the door frame, guaranteeing it is level and protect. Use screws to connect the frame to the wall or door frame.
Step 5: Add the Door Panel
Connect the door panel to the frame, following the maker's instructions for assembly and installation.
Action 6: Test the Door
Check the door to ensure it is working effectively, and make any needed adjustments to the alignment or tension.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: How do I pick the best size cat door for my pet?
A: Measure your cat's width and height to determine the ideal door size. Speak with Repair My Windows And Doors or a pet expert for assistance.
Q: How do I avoid drafts and moisture from going into through the cat door?
A: Install a weatherproof seal or threshold to minimize drafts and moisture. Regularly tidy and keep the door to prevent damage.
Q: Can I install an indoor cat door in a load-bearing wall?
A: It is recommended to prevent installing cat doors in load-bearing walls, as this can compromise the structural stability of your home. Talk to a professional if you're unsure.
Q: How do I keep other animals or bugs from going into through the cat door?
A: Install a secure locking system or utilize a magnetic closure system to avoid undesirable entry. Consider adding a screen or mesh to keep pests and insects out.
